CVE-2026-59316

Spring Authorization Server

Description

Spring Authorization Server-s default consent page renders user-controlled values without HTML entity encoding. When using the DefaultConsentPage, an attacker can craft an OAuth2 authorization request containing a malicious value that is stored server-side and later rendered unencoded in the default consent page presented to the end user. Spring Authorization Server 1.5.0 - 1.5.8 Spring Authorization Server 1.4.0 - 1.4.11
